Reconfirming His Academic Role

Huberman remains a tenured professor at Stanford University School of Medicine, where his research explores neuroplasticity, vision, and stress regulation through the Huberman Lab.

Reconfirming His Education

His PhD in neuroscience from the University of California, Davis, followed by postdoctoral training at Stanford, continues to form the foundation of his professional expertise.

Reconfirming His Publication Record

With over fifty peer reviewed papers published in journals such as Nature, Neuron, and Cell, his research contribution remains substantial and well documented.
